What I liked:
Very good photo quality (though see issues below)
12X zoom lens with optical image stabilization
Blazing performance (except for focusing speeds, which are just average)
Full manual controls
Awesome movie mode: VGA resolution (30 fps), stereo sound, zoom ability, wind screen, selectable audio quality/level
Great continuous shooting mode
Flip-out, rotating 1.8 LCD display; LCD (and EVF too) is visible in low light
AF-assist l good low light focusing
0 cm macro mode for ultra close-ups
Handy shortcut button and custom spot on mode dial
Time lapse photography feature
Unique My Colors feature (though its only available in one automatic shooting mode)
Excellent battery life
USB 2.0 High Speed support
Optional conversion lenses and external slave flash
Impressive software bundle; camera can be controlled from your Mac or PC
What I didnt care for:
Images a little too sharp; a few were a tad overexposed
Movie mode file size limit arrives quickly
Some redeye
No live histogram in record mode (still!)
Plastic tripod mount (hey Im only complaining because it used to be metal)
RAW support, manual focus ring wouldve been nice
Tiny memory card, crappy lens cap, and throwaway batteries included with camera
